
Show Us Your Hands
From 3 Cops Talk - Rebuilding Community Trust by Chris Sherwin, Scott Thorsen & Shaun Ferguson
June 5, 2026 · 33 min · Episode 293
About this episode
This episode discusses a traffic stop that leads to ironic revelations about police misconduct and community trust.
Let us know what you think of this episode with a text! A traffic stop for a hands-free device violation turns into a lesson in irony, an Indiana police chief gets caught with his hand in the evidence room cookie jar after allegedly selling seized firearms to pawn shops, and the Minneapolis police chief resigns amid allegations of “getting handy” with multiple city employees.
